Understanding the Basics: How Online Casinos Work

Online casinos operate similarly to their brick-and-mortar counterparts, but with a digital twist. Instead of visiting a physical location, you access games through a website or a dedicated app. The core functionality revolves around software that simulates the games, such as poker, blackjack, roulette, and slot machines. These games use Random Number Generators (RNGs) to ensure fairness and randomness in the outcomes. Reputable online casinos are regularly audited by independent bodies to verify the integrity of their RNGs and ensure that the games are not rigged.

To participate, you typically need to create an account, provide personal information, and deposit funds using various payment methods, such as credit cards, debit cards, e-wallets, or bank transfers. The casino then credits your account with the deposited amount, which you can use to place bets on the available games. Winnings are credited back to your account, and you can withdraw them using the same payment methods (or others) that the casino supports.

Navigating the Legal Landscape in Australia

The legal framework surrounding online gambling in Australia is complex and varies across different states and territories. The Interactive Gambling Act 2001 (IGA) is the primary legislation governing online gambling. The IGA prohibits online casinos from offering their services to Australian residents, but it does not prohibit Australians from using offshore online casinos. However, it’s crucial to understand that using offshore platforms comes with risks, as these casinos may not be subject to Australian consumer protection laws.

The legality of online gambling also depends on the specific game. For example, sports betting is generally legal, provided the operator holds a license from an Australian state or territory. However, online casino games, such as slots and table games, are generally prohibited for Australian-based operators. This has led to a situation where many Australians play at offshore online casinos. It’s essential to research and understand the legal status of the platform you intend to use and the specific games you wish to play.

Responsible Gambling: Playing Smart and Staying Safe

Responsible gambling is crucial for anyone engaging in online gambling. It involves setting limits, managing your bankroll, and recognizing the signs of problem gambling. Here are some key principles to follow:

  • Set a Budget: Before you start playing, determine how much money you can afford to lose. Never gamble with money you cannot afford to lose.
  • Set Time Limits: Decide how much time you will spend gambling and stick to your schedule. Avoid gambling for extended periods.
  • Avoid Chasing Losses: Never try to recoup your losses by betting more. This can lead to a cycle of debt and further losses.
  • Take Breaks: Regularly take breaks from gambling to clear your head and avoid impulsive decisions.
  • Know the Signs of Problem Gambling: If you find yourself gambling more than you intended, experiencing financial difficulties, or neglecting your responsibilities, seek help from a gambling support service.
  • Utilize Self-Exclusion Tools: Most online casinos offer self-exclusion options, allowing you to temporarily or permanently block yourself from accessing their platform.

Several organizations in Australia offer support and resources for problem gamblers, including Gambling Help Online and Lifeline. These services provide confidential counseling, support groups, and information on responsible gambling practices.
